Warning: error_log(/data/www/wwwroot/hmttv.cn/caches/error_log.php): failed to open stream: Permission denied in /data/www/wwwroot/hmttv.cn/phpcms/libs/functions/global.func.php on line 537 Warning: error_log(/data/www/wwwroot/hmttv.cn/caches/error_log.php): failed to open stream: Permission denied in /data/www/wwwroot/hmttv.cn/phpcms/libs/functions/global.func.php on line 537
億互聯網用戶需求,促使300萬WEB前端人才缺口。HTML5的蔓延讓不少開發商發現了機遇,HTML5開發人才也遭受瘋搶,但傳統前端人才很難駕馭移動端,因此,HTML5開發人才出現嚴重緊缺狀態,很多企業陷入兩難境地。
據統計,我國對于高級HTML5開發人員的缺口將達到12萬左右。目前,北京、上海、廣州、深圳等地HTML5開發人員的薪資待遇更是一高再高。想成為一名優秀的HTML5開發人員嗎?那么這份學習資料值得大家收藏學習了。
一.HTML5初級開發工程師
1.HTML5介紹
互聯網發展趨勢
H5語言的優勢
簡單易學人人都能編程
H5就業和薪資情況
H5常見的項目與產品
H5的未來與方向
2.HTML基礎
HTML簡介與歷史版本
常用開發軟件
常見標簽與屬性
表格與表單
標簽規范與標簽語義化
實戰:網頁結構布局
3.CSS基礎
css簡介與基本語法
常見的各種樣式屬性
CSS選擇器與標簽類型
理解盒子模型與CSS重置
浮動與定位
利用photoshop工具測量樣式
HTML+CSS開發網頁
實戰:高仿電商首頁效果
4.CSS3基礎
css3常見樣式
css3選擇器
變形與動畫
3D效果與關鍵幀
彈性盒模型
5.移動端布局
移動端基本概念
viewport窗口設置
移動端布局方案
rem、vh、vw等單位
響應式布局
bootstrap框架
6.JavaScript基礎
JS簡介
JS變量
數據類型與類型轉換
運算符與優先級
流程控制-if..else
流程控制-switch...case
流程控制-while、do..while、for循環
break、continue語法
函數定義與調用
全局變量與局部變量
函數傳參與返回值
函數作用域與變量作用域
DOM的基本操作
定時器使用
this指向與修改指向
數組、字符串等方法操作
時間對象與正則對象
掌握常見BOM操作
常見事件與事件細節
JSON與AJAX
JSONP跨域操作
前端cookie的使用
實戰:JS配合HTML與CSS完成電商項目
7.jquery框架
jquery框架介紹及優勢介紹
jquery核心思想
jquery常見方法
jquery動畫操作
jqueryAJAX操作
jquery工具方法
利用jquery快速開發網頁
8.PHP基礎
PHP簡介與基本語法
mysql數據庫及sql語法
apache服務器與集成開發工具
PHP鏈接數據庫
PHP與AJAX交互
實戰:留言板、登錄、注冊等
9.H5基礎項目
項目簡介
項目功能演示
項目劃分及框架
編寫HTML頁面結構
設置CSS樣式
添加JS交互
可選框架:bootstrap、jquery、PHP等
項目調試及兼容
項目驗收
二.HTML5中高級開發工程師
1.面向對象基礎
面向對象概述
對象和構造函數(類)之間的關系
對象的屬性和方法
原型與原型鏈
包裝對象與內部實現
對象中實現繼承方式
設計模式及實際運用
2.JavaScript高級
JS算法與排序算法
promise異步處理
運動與tween算法
閉包與模塊化
JS組件開發
打造小型jquery框架
JS性能優化
ES6新增功能
3.前端工程化
gulp基本使用
less、sass、babel等預編譯框架
理解模塊概念,AMD與CMD規范
前端模塊框架seaJS、requireJS
webpack基本使用
4.多人協作
svn基本用法與可視化工具
多人開發流程
git基本用法
命令行操作
分區及分支等概念
遠程github操作
實戰:多人協作開發項目
5.HTML5新功能
canvas繪圖
svg繪圖
音頻與視頻
本地存儲與離線存儲
地理信息
web Worker
web Socket
6.NodeJS基礎
node與npm概念及使用
node模塊方式
node常用內置模塊
node爬蟲與文件自動化處理
node搭建服務器與簡單路由
mongodb非關系數據庫
mongodb安裝與db操作
mongodb增刪改查
mongodb與node結合開發
mongoose數據建模
mongoose與node結合開發
express框架
中間件與ejs模板引擎
Robomongo與postman工具
express+mongoose搭建后端框架
設計Restful API
實戰:前后端分離式開發
7.微信端開發
移動端交互與移動端事件
微信場景與swiper框架
微信公眾號介紹
網頁授權與JSSDK
微信web開發者工具使用
微信小程序開發
實戰:公眾號與小程序項目同步開發
三.HTML5大神級開發工程師
1.VueJS框架
Vue框架簡介
漸進式與響應式
模板語法與計算屬性
指令與數據處理器
生命周期
組件與組件通信
Vuex狀態管理
Vue動畫與路由
單文件組件與腳手架
基于Vue的組件框架
實戰:Vue與Node全棧開發
2.ReactJS框架
React框架簡介
JSX語法
組件與組件通信
屬性與狀態設置
虛擬DOM
生命周期
redux架構
react-redux使用
react-router使用
Mem腳手架使用
實戰:React與Node全棧開發
3.AngularJS框架
Angular框架簡介
TypeScript基礎與進階
開發環境配置
架構、模塊與組件
模板、元數據與數據顯示
服務于指令
依賴注入
路由
實戰:Angular與Node全棧開發
4.Hybrid App開發
App介紹與分類
Android/ios與H5通信
Cordova/Phonegap框架
HTML5+基于HB工具
React Native
5.前端架構
單元測試與編寫測試用例
自動化測試方案
前端安全與HTTP協議
項目上線與一鍵部署
數據統計與SEO優化
搭建組件庫與按需載入
瀏覽器渲染與瀏覽器引擎
深入理解后端開發模式
更多學習資料,戳左下角哦~
學目標:
1. 理解前端開發的基本概念和原理。
- 前端開發的定義和作用
- 前端開發的基本工具和環境
- 前端開發的職責和要求
2. 掌握HTML5標記語言的基本語法、元素和屬性。
- HTML5的發展歷程和版本
- HTML5文檔結構和基本語法規范
- HTML5常用的文本標記、圖像標記、表格標記等
- HTML5的表單元素和相關屬性
3. 掌握CSS3的基本語法、選擇器和常用樣式屬性。
- CSS3的發展歷程和版本
- CSS3的基本語法和選擇器
- CSS3的盒模型、布局和浮動
- CSS3的文本樣式、背景樣式和過渡動畫
it學習
4. 理解JavaScript的基本語法、數據類型、條件語句和循環結構。
- JavaScript的基本語法和變量定義
- JavaScript的數據類型和類型轉換
- JavaScript的條件語句和邏輯運算
- JavaScript的循環結構和數組操作
5. 掌握DOM操作,能夠使用JavaScript操作HTML文檔中的元素。
- DOM的概念和基本原理
- 使用JavaScript獲取和操作HTML元素
- 使用JavaScript創建、修改和刪除HTML元素
- DOM事件的處理和綁定
6. 理解響應式設計的概念和基本原理。
- 響應式設計的定義和作用
- 使用媒體查詢實現頁面布局的適應性
- 使用流式布局和彈性盒子布局實現頁面適配
- 使用響應式圖片等技術提升頁面響應性
軟件開發
大綱精細化教學設計:
第一部分:前端開發基礎
1. 前端開發概述
1.1 什么是前端開發
1.2 前端開發的歷史和發展趨勢
1.3 前端開發的基本工具和環境
2. HTML5基礎
2.1 HTML5的簡介和發展歷程
2.2 HTML5的文檔結構和基本語法規范
2.3 HTML5常用的文本標記、圖像標記、鏈接標記等
2.4 HTML5的表單元素和相關屬性
3. CSS3基礎
3.1 CSS3的簡介和發展歷程
3.2 CSS3的基本語法和選擇器
3.3 CSS3的盒模型、布局和浮動
3.4 CSS3的文本樣式、背景樣式和過渡動畫
4. JavaScript基礎
4.1 JavaScript的簡介和發展歷程
4.2 JavaScript的基本語法和變量定義
4.3 JavaScript的數據類型和類型轉換
4.4 JavaScript的條件語句和邏輯運算
4.5 JavaScript的循環結構和數組操作
小程序開發
第二部分:網頁交互與動態效果
1. DOM操作
1.1 DOM的概念和基本原理
1.2 使用JavaScript獲取和操作HTML元素
1.3 使用JavaScript創建、修改和刪除HTML元素
1.4 DOM事件的處理和綁定
2. 事件處理與表單驗證
2.1 常見的DOM事件類型和觸發條件
2.2 使用JavaScript處理交互事件
2.3 表單驗證的基本原理和實現方法
3. Ajax與數據交互
3.1 Ajax的簡介和發展歷程
3.2 使用JavaScript發送異步請求
3.3 處理服務器返回的數據
第三部分:響應式設計與跨平臺開發
1. 響應式設計概述
1.1 響應式設計的定義和作用
1.2 媒體查詢的基本語法和常用屬性
1.3 使用響應式設計實現網頁適配
2. 移動端開發概述
2.1 移動端開發的特點和挑戰
2.2 使用CSS3實現移動端樣式效果
2.3 使用JavaScript處理移動端交互
3. 跨平臺開發基礎
3.1 常見的跨平臺開發技術和框架
3.2 使用跨平臺開發工具搭建應用
3.3 測試和發布跨平臺應用
通過以上的教學目標和大綱精細化教學設計,學習者將能夠全面掌握前端開發所需的HTML5、CSS3和JavaScript的基礎知識,并能夠應用所學知識實現網頁交互和動態效果,以及具備響應式設計和跨平臺開發的能力。
習html5的同學越來越多,但是很多都是零基礎或者轉行過來學習的,很多人對于html5都不是很了解,那么要學習哪些內容,哪些適合零基礎的同學去學習,今天html5零基礎教程學習大綱分享給大家參考學習。
杭州html5零基礎教程學習大綱分享
那么想要學好html5前端開發,那么需要掌握的專業技術有:
第一階段:前端頁面重構:PC端網站布局、HTML5+CSS3基礎項目、WebAPP頁面布局;
第二階段:JavaScript高級程序設計:原生JavaScript交互功能開發、面向對象開發與ES5/ES6、JavaScript工具庫自主研發;
第三階段:PC端全棧項目開發:jQuery經典特效交互開發、HTTP協議,Ajxa進階與后端開發、前端工程化與模塊化應用、PC端網站開發、PC端管理信息系統前端開發;
第四階段:移動端webAPP開發:Touch端項目、微信場景項目、應用Vue.js開發WebApp項目、應用Ionic開發WebApp項目、應用React.js開發WebApp;
第五階段:混合(Hybrid)開發:各類混合應用開發;
第六階段:NodeJS全棧開發:WebApp后端系統開發;
第七階段:大數據可視化:數據可視化入門、D3.jS詳解及項目實戰。
一個好的課程內容可以讓我們學習的時候更清晰,更好的掌握學習的方向千鋒教育在學習內容基礎上2018年又全面升級了課程內容。全棧HTML5+課程大綱V10.0
HTML5課程升級后優勢
課程大綱升級后,覆蓋熱門大數據可視化內容,深度貫穿前端后端開發,緊貼主流企業一線需求,注重項目和實戰能力,真正做到項目制教學,業內罕見。
課程特色:注重全棧思維培養
全棧HTML5工程師不止是技術層面,千鋒著力培養學員的大前端視角與全棧思維,就業后不僅有能力解決工作中的疑難問題,更有實力勝任項目leader!
HTML5課程升級內容
1.新增時下大熱的大數據可視化內容
2.深化PHP+MySQL開發內容
3.20大項目驅動教學
千鋒教育html5課程貫穿項目實戰于其中:大型企業項目實戰,覆蓋各行各業實戰項目,千鋒自行研發的升級版教學大綱,結合多項商業案例學習,讓學員擁有理論基礎,同時更具實踐能力。教學團隊擁有多年教學經驗,百人教學天團,擁有高超的授課技巧和實戰視野,讓你理論和實戰兼得。
想學習html5的同學還猶豫什么呢?快去千鋒報名學習吧,快速的學習才能讓你快人一步,更好的把握機會。
*請認真填寫需求信息,我們會在24小時內與您取得聯系。